Output 8ecb02ccee0ae8200619248b7d3b0b4587423107ad2e0c47611bcbe0f39d62c1:84

value
184110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 873db3f04973a2fb56eacdecd3830a9e8ff24a5a OP_EQUAL
address
3E274ddwKVtZ9tFNv9V5UgN1nkr9LxCTPP
transaction
8ecb02ccee0ae8200619248b7d3b0b4587423107ad2e0c47611bcbe0f39d62c1
confirmations
199552
spent
true